Why Braces?

There are many reasons that people decide to get braces, and not all of them are aesthetic. Braces can improve your bite, help make eating more comfortable and make it easier to properly look after teeth and gums.

Environmental degradation is made worse by our inferior waste disposal methods. Oil disposal is especially a big problem, with most home, restaurants; hotels, etc. include either pouring it down the drains or sending it to landfills. To stop further environmental degradation, people should learn about alternative methods of used cooking oil disposal.

Used cooking oil can be recycled and used for very many purposes, including biofuel, making soap, pesticides, compost catalyst, and many more uses. There are many benefits to recycling used cooking oil, which include:

Producing Clean and Renewable Energy

One of the most significant benefits of recycling cooking oil is clean and renewable energy. We have relied too much on non-renewable energy, which has caused massive degradation of the environment. Non- renewable energy is energy that comes from natural sources that will eventually run out. These sources such as coal, natural gas and petroleum took millions of years to form, and cannot be renewed for another several million years. To ensure we stop degrading the environment further, we need to shift towards renewable energy sources such as biofuel, derived from used cooking oil.

Job Creation

Globally, trillions of liters of cooking oil are produced annually. Recycling this oil and turning it into clean fuel can help to reduce the high global unemployment rate. A rise in job availability for the youth will go a long way in reducing the rates of poverty, empowering marginalized communities and generally improve the life quality of millions around the world.

Lower Cost of Repairs and Less Cleaning Up

Most homes and facilities such as restaurants and hotels prefer to dispose of used cooking oil by pouring down the drain system. People erroneously assume the oil will go to treatment plants where the oil is filtered out before the wastewater is directed elsewhere. The oil does a lot of harm to the drainage system and the public sewerage.

The oil solidifies in the pipes when it cools, clogging the pipes and leading to high costs of unclogging the system when experts come to repair.When your kitchen drainage is blocked, it clogs the entire sewer system by default, and this leads to spills into the streets, which are very costly to clean and pose a threat to people’s lives.

There are a few tips on how to dispose of your used cooking oil:

  • Check online for a reputable used cooking oil recycling company. Their ratings on the internet will tell you a lot about the quality of service.
  • Get advice from the Environmental Health Office
  • Don’t dispose of the cooking oil with the other kitchen waste and don’t pour it down drains to prevent costly repairs
  • Keep the oil containers away from any drainage system to avoid leakages or spills. Check online for ways in which you can store the oil.
  • Makes use of a grease trap and ensure it is emptied regularly. Most oil recyclers’ packages include a grease trap cleaning service
  • For a restaurant, train your staff on the significance of keeping oil, grease and fat from the sewers and drains.

Uses of Mesotherapy

Originally, Mesotherapy was utilized to relieve pain but with recent research, its benefits have expanded. At present, it is well known for a lot of uses ranging from reducing cellulite to reducing wrinkles, regrowth of hair and even decreasing fat in areas such as thighs, hips, face, arms, and so on.

How much does it usually cost?

The usual cost of each session of Mesotherapy ranges from $250 to $600 depending on the type of session you are planning to get. As it is mainly a cosmetic treatment in nature, insurance companies don’t take up the cost.

Treatment precautions and procedure

Precautions: A common precaution to be taken before going for the treatment is stopping the intake of nonsteroidal anti-inflammatory drugs such as aspirin and so on. This precaution should be taken well before one week of the treatment. You should ask your doctor what other precautions must be taken as it may differ from individual to individual. Intake of aspirin and other such medications can increase the risk of bleeding and bruising during the procedure. So it’s important to be cautious.

Procedure: The doctor might apply numbing cream on the area to initiate the procedure. A series of short injections ranging from 1mm to 4mm is used in accordance with your skin condition. To get the anticipated effect, a couple of more sessions (3 to 15 times) may be required. The initial 7 injections are given in periods of 10 days. Post this you will start witnessing the effect of the treatment.

However, it varies from individual to individual as the vitamins; elements injected in the body may react differently for everyone. Most people do not understand the importance of warming up exercises, especially in contact sports such as Rugby, especially when you are limited to just a few hours of training per week.

Why warm up?

When starting to exercise, your body needs to make some adjustments. These include:

improve breathing and heart rate;

increased reaction releases energy in the muscles;

promote blood flow to the muscles to supply them with more oxygen and to remove waste products.

This adjustment does not happen immediately, it takes several minutes to reach the required level. So, the purpose of warming up is to encourage these adjustments to occur gradually, starting with your training session on an easy level and gradually increasing the intensity. If you start exercising at full capacity without warming up, your body will not be ready for the higher demands made of it, which can cause injuries and unnecessary fatigue.

What is a warm up exercise ?

A warm-up usually takes the form of some gentle exercise that gradually increases in intensity.

A pre-workout warm up:

increases blood flow to the muscles, which improves the delivery of oxygen and nutrients;

warms up your muscles, which promotes reactions that release energy used during exercise and makes the muscles more supple;

readies your muscles for stretching;

readiesyour heart for an increase in activity;

readies you mentally for the upcoming exercise;

primes your neural pathways-to-the muscles ready for exercise; and

prevent unnecessary stress and fatigue placed on your muscles, heart and lungs, which can occur if you are exercising hard without warming.

Warming up is widely seen as a simple measure to prepare your body for exercise of moderate to high intensity and is thought to assist the body in protecting against injury. Despite no real concrete evidence that the warming prevents injuries, anecdotal evidence and logic would suggest that the warming should reduce the risk.

Ensure effective warming up

To make your warmupeffective, you should aim for movements that up the heart rate, breathing levels and warms up the temperature of your muscles. A strong sign of an effective warm up is reaching the point where you are beginning to sweat.

If you’re exercising for general fitness, allow 5 to 10 minutes for your pre-workout warm up (or slightly longer in cold weather).

If you exercise at a level that goes further than simply for general fitness, or play a specific sport, you will most likely require a longer warm-up, and one that is designed specifically for your sport.

  1. General

To start, you should do a 5-minute warm up of light (low intensity) physical activity such as walking, jogging in place or cycling. Incorporate movement with your arms, such as controlled circular motions with your arms to help warm the muscles of your upper body.

  1. Specific warm up forsports

One of the best ways to warm up is to do exercises that will come at a slow pace. This enables you to simulate the higher intensity activities of the chosen sport but in a lower intensity to begin with. Some ideas include stable jogging, cycling or swimming before progressing to a faster pace. This can then be followed by a few sport-specific movements and activities, shoulder rolls, through simulation, or side-stepping and lunges for Rugby.
